In this blog I wish to share my thoughts on the subjects of natural and human sciences, philosophy and whatever crosses my mind and I consider worth sharing. Consilience is a word recently brought back in fashion by E.O. Wilson who proposes to unify knowledge by melding natural sciences with all other branches of knowledge. I find this enterprise just great!